Annual Export Value, Volume, and Supplier Market Size for Raw Areca Nut in Sri Lanka (HS Code 080280)

Analyze 2 years of Raw Areca Nut export volume and value in Sri Lanka to evaluate supplier market growth, seasonality, and trade volatility.
YearVolumeValue
20248,851,87237,999,335 USD
202314,051,38860,621,468 USD

Top Destination Markets for Raw Areca Nut Exports from Sri Lanka (HS Code 080280) in 2024

For 2024, compare export volume and value across the top 2 destination countries for Raw Areca Nut exports from Sri Lanka.
RankCountryVolumeValue
1India8,826,39037,913,008.982 USD
2Maldives25,48286,326.412 USD

Raw Areca Nut Farmgate Supplier Cost Trends in Sri Lanka

Monitor Raw Areca Nut farmgate supplier cost benchmarks and latest origin-side cost movements in Sri Lanka.

Historical Raw Areca Nut Farmgate Supplier Prices in Sri Lanka (USD/kg)

Yearly average, lower, and upper farmgate prices with YoY changes reveal origin-side supplier cost trends for Raw Areca Nut in Sri Lanka.
Raw Areca Nut yearly average farmgate prices in Sri Lanka: 2021: 2.48 USD / kg, 2022: 3.62 USD / kg, 2023: 3.08 USD / kg, 2024: 2.52 USD / kg.
YearAverage Unit PriceLower Unit PriceUpper Unit PriceYoY Change
20212.48 USD / kg1.67 USD / kg3.27 USD / kg-
20223.62 USD / kg2.14 USD / kg4.52 USD / kg-
20233.08 USD / kg1.91 USD / kg3.72 USD / kg-
20242.52 USD / kg2.28 USD / kg3.01 USD / kg-

Market

Raw areca nut (betel nut) in Sri Lanka is produced domestically and is used in local betel (betel-quid) consumption, while national accounts documentation also describes the crop as mainly an export item. Seasonality is generally described as weak, with growing/harvesting activity occurring throughout the year. For export shipments, Sri Lanka’s National Plant Quarantine Service (NPQS) procedures for phytosanitary certification apply to plant and plant products. A key market-access risk is regulatory scrutiny because areca nut is classified as carcinogenic to humans (IARC Group 1), which can drive import restrictions, warning requirements, or buyer exclusions in some destination markets.

Risks

Regulatory Compliance HighDestination-market access can be blocked or severely constrained because areca nut is classified as carcinogenic to humans (IARC Group 1), which can drive import restrictions, warning requirements, financial-institution exclusions, or buyer prohibitions for areca-nut products.Confirm legality and any special restrictions in the specific destination country before contracting; align labeling/marketing with importer guidance and seek regulatory counsel where needed.
Food Safety MediumMycotoxin risk can emerge from poor storage/processing conditions; a Sri Lanka study of commercially available areca products reported aflatoxin contamination in at least one prepared areca-nut product type, highlighting the need for moisture control and testing in the supply chain.Implement strict moisture and hygiene controls in drying/storage; use lot-based sampling with accredited aflatoxin testing and provide certificates of analysis to buyers.
Logistics MediumSea-freight disruptions and container-rate volatility can increase landed cost and create shipment delays for bulk dried-nut consignments, affecting delivery reliability and margins.Use forward freight planning, buffer lead times, and contract terms that allocate freight risk clearly; prioritize moisture-protective packaging for long transit.

FAQ

Which documents are commonly needed to export raw areca nuts from Sri Lanka?Exports of plant and plant products generally require a phytosanitary certificate issued by Sri Lanka’s National Plant Quarantine Service (NPQS). Depending on the importing country’s conditions, NPQS also notes that treatment certificates (for example fumigation or chemical treatment reports) and other shipment documents (such as invoices) may be needed.
Does Sri Lanka require an import permit for bringing areca nuts into the country?For plants and plant products, Sri Lanka’s NPQS states that an import permit is required under the Plant Protection Act No. 35 of 1999, with conditions depending on the risk and country of origin.
Why can areca nuts face strict regulatory scrutiny in some markets?The International Agency for Research on Cancer (IARC) states that areca nut has been classified as carcinogenic to humans (Group 1). This can lead some destination markets and buyers to restrict, warn against, or exclude areca-nut products.
